Description:
Ergosta-8,24(28)-dien-26-oic acid, 4-methyl-3,11-dioxo-, (4a,5a,25S)-, with the CAS number 163597-24-8, is a chemical compound that belongs to the class of sterols and is characterized by its complex steroidal structure. This compound features multiple functional groups, including a carboxylic acid and dioxo moieties, which contribute to its reactivity and potential biological activity. The presence of double bonds in the ergosterol backbone indicates unsaturation, which can influence its interactions with biological membranes and enzymes. The stereochemistry, denoted by the (4a,5a,25S)- configuration, suggests specific spatial arrangements of atoms that may affect the compound's pharmacological properties. Ergosta derivatives are often studied for their roles in various biological processes, including their potential as antifungal agents and their involvement in cellular signaling pathways. Overall, this compound's unique structural features make it a subject of interest in medicinal chemistry and biochemistry research.
